简介:本文介绍了如何使用Python代码实现自动写小说的流程,并推荐了几款好用的AI智能写作软件,包括悟智写作等,这些软件能够大幅提高写作效率和质量。
在文学创作领域,人工智能的应用正逐渐展现出其巨大的潜力。通过使用Python等编程语言,我们可以实现自动写小说的功能,为作家们提供强大的辅助工具。本文将详细介绍如何使用Python代码实现自动写小说,并推荐几款好用的AI智能写作软件。
实现自动写小说的过程,主要涉及到文本生成库的选择、训练数据的准备、模型的训练、文本的生成以及优化等步骤。以下是一个简化的流程:
以下是一个使用transformers库生成小说的简单示例代码:
from transformers import GPT2LMHeadModel, GPT2Tokenizer# 加载预训练的模型和分词器tokenizer = GPT2Tokenizer.from_pretrained('gpt2')model = GPT2LMHeadModel.from_pretrained('gpt2')# 读取训练数据(此处省略具体实现)# training_data = read_training_data('your_training_data.txt')# 编码训练数据(此处省略具体实现)# inputs = tokenizer(training_data, return_tensors='pt', max_length=512, truncation=True)# 模型训练(此处省略具体实现,因为涉及到大量超参数设置和循环结构)# model.train()# outputs = model(**inputs)# 生成文本def generate_text(prompt, max_length=200):input_ids = tokenizer.encode(prompt, return_tensors='pt')output = model.generate(input_ids, max_length=max_length, num_return_sequences=1)return tokenizer.decode(output[0], skip_special_tokens=True)prompt = "Once upon a time"novel_text = generate_text(prompt)print(novel_text)
除了自己编写代码实现自动写小说外,我们还可以使用一些现成的AI智能写作软件。这些软件通常提供了更加友好的用户界面和丰富的功能,使得写作过程更加便捷和高效。
悟智写作:悟智写作是一款由人工智能驱动的智能写作工具,它覆盖了包括100多种不同行业和使用场景的文本模版,能够帮助用户快速生成高质量的内容。悟智写作不仅支持中文写作,还提供了多种语言的选择,使得跨国创作变得更加容易。
笔灵AI写作:笔灵AI写作是一款能够快速生成高质量内容的智能写作软件。它利用了先进的人工智能技术,能够根据用户提供的关键词或主题,自动生成故事情节或角色对话。
千帆大模型开发与服务平台:虽然千帆大模型开发与服务平台本身不是一款直接的写作软件,但它提供了丰富的AI模型和服务,包括文本生成等。用户可以在该平台上选择合适的模型进行训练和应用,以实现自动写小说的功能。
通过使用Python代码或AI智能写作软件,我们可以实现自动写小说的功能,为作家们提供强大的辅助工具。这些工具不仅能够提高写作效率和质量,还能够激发作家的创作灵感。未来,随着人工智能技术的不断发展,我们期待这些工具能够带来更加出色的性能和更加丰富的功能。同时,作家们也应该充分利用这些工具,发挥自己的创造力和想象力,创作出真正优秀的文学作品。